WebMar 29, 2024 · 23% of frequent users in a population sample of MA abusers reported MAP or psychotic symptoms (McKetin et al., 2006). Around 40% of persons with MA dependency in a hospital-based research group may have psychotic symptoms, such as paranoia, throughout their lifetime use of MA (Kalayasiri et al., 2014).
